最近,很多粉丝问我阿尔法协议和贝塔协议到底有什么区别,我就决定亲自实践一遍,搞个清晰点儿的分析。说心里话,我之前也只是听说名字,自己都没仔细比较过。上周我闲得没事儿,就开始动手了。
我直接开电脑查资料,先看阿尔法协议是啥玩意儿。我找到一堆英文文档,但翻得头大,干脆我就去论坛里问大佬们。结果有个哥们回复说:“阿尔法协议,就是那种讲规则的玩意儿,像合同一样硬邦邦的,不改就不能变。”我就想,这不就是那种老式软件吗?功能固定得很,一点更新机会都没有。折腾了好几天,我在自己手机上装了个模拟工具,试着用阿尔法协议做点小事儿,比如传个文件。结果差点没把我气死!速度慢得像蜗牛爬,传个照片要等老半天,还动不动就报错。
具体对比的过程
接着我就换个思路,去研究贝塔协议。我上网搜了好几个视频教程,跟着一步步操作。先下载了个贝塔协议的应用包,这玩意儿安装起来倒挺快。我试着用它传同样的照片,豁,速度嗖嗖的,眨眼就搞定了。我心想差别咋这么大?就拉了个表出来记笔记,列了一堆点:
- 灵活性方面:阿尔法协议死脑筋,规则都是固定的,我要加个新功能,就得从头改一遍代码。贝塔协议?能随时调整,像玩儿橡皮泥,捏捏捏就成了我想要的形状。
- 使用难易度:阿尔法协议要用命令行,一堆命令敲得我手酸。贝塔协议点几下界面就完事儿,小白也能上手,完全不费劲。
- 稳定性:刚开始我以为阿尔法协议更稳,结果跑测试时它动不动就崩溃,数据都弄丢了。贝塔协议没这事,跑了一天也没出岔子。
搞到中间,我还试了一下真实场景。我把两个协议都装在路由器上,给家里的网络设备用。阿尔法协议让视频卡顿得要命,老婆骂我说搞啥高科技。换成贝塔协议,立马流畅了,老婆都夸我厉害。这过程中,我还发现贝塔协议支持多点连接,能同时连手机和电脑;阿尔法协议只能单线作战,效率太低了。
总结出来的区别
搞了整整一周,我总算把实践理清楚了。简单说,阿尔法协议和贝塔的区别就这些:
- 阿尔法协议:适合那种老旧系统,不需要频繁改动的场景。比如工厂机器控制啥的,设置好就永不用管。缺点是不灵活,还容易卡壳。
- 贝塔协议:现代设备好用,速度快又灵活,能适应新需求。我用它搞网络传文件,省时省力,关键是不怕报错。
整个实践下来,我自己的体会是:如果非要选一个,贝塔协议肯定更实用。我在工作室搞定了测试路由器,现在全屋都用贝塔了。哈哈,以后再有人问,我就直接甩这篇,省得费劲儿解释!
